(D) The first ionization energy of Na is less than that of Mg. ️Answer/ExplanationQuestions 1-3 are long free-response questions that require about 23 minutes each to answer and are worth 10 points each. Questions 4-7 are short free-response questions that require about 9 minutes each to answer and are worth 4 points each. For each question, show your work for each part in the space provided after that part.answer with justification.
